An architecturally designed luxury house in a tranquil setting in the Chiltern Hills

Description
Ossicles is an incredible home standing in a most private position on the edge of the village of Stoke Row in the Chiltern Hills. The bespoke design maximises the enjoyment of the views from all areas of the house and creates a luxurious feeling of volume and open plan living from the moment you step into the house.

The wonderful interiors, combined with high quality fittings and materials, are everything you would expect in a luxury home, with open plan entertaining and family spaces complemented by quite areas for peace and relaxation.

Notable features include extensive glass, full-height and gently sloping ceilings, creating a distinctive style to enjoy throughout the day and seasons. A double-height hallway leads to accommodation arranged over three floors with a glass staircase and walkway enhancing the light and views.

Planning permission was granted in October 2022 for a new garage block and landscaping, (sodc reference P22/S3021/hh.)

Location
Located in the most idyllic location on a leafy lane through Bluebell woodland, Ossicles is located in Newnham Hill just outside the highly regarded village of Stoke Row and a short drive from Henley-on-Thames. The immediate area is a haven for walking, riding and country pursuits.

There are two superb pubs, The Cherry Tree and The Rising Sun within walking distance as well as the renowned restaurant, The Crooked Billet, and The Cheese Shed at Nettlebed for an incredible home made cheese toastie and coffee! Stoke Row itself has a vibrant community with an independent village store/coffee shop, primary school as well as tennis and cricket clubs.

Transport links are close by, including the Elizabeth Line to central London from either Reading or Twyford. There are numerous renowned schools in the area including The Oratory, Moulsford, Pangbourne College and Bradfield as well as some super village schools.
